气囊置换充填体工艺研究  被引量:1

Research on Technology of Replacing Filling body with Airbag

摘  要:矾山磷矿采用的采矿方法为平底结构分段凿岩阶段出矿嗣后充填采矿法。原回采工艺存在二次掘进充填体、频繁搬运凿岩设备和出渣设备、制作充填挡墙存在安全隐患以及矿房之间生产接续时间长等问题。阐述了气囊置换充填体工艺,该工艺主要是向外调整了充填挡墙位置,在充填挡墙内放置一个充气囊,气囊周边放置滤水管,用气囊占用一定的体积,从而回采相邻矿房时不需要二次掘充填体。该工艺使盘区内相邻矿房回采前不再需要二次掘进充填体,缩短了矿房之间回采衔接时间约15天;解决了充填体需要分开提升到地表的问题;提升了生产效率,为类似矿山采用充填法采矿提供了经验。The mining method used in the Fanshan Phosphate Mine is the flat-bottom structure staged rock drilling stage mining method followed by filling mining method.The original mining process has problems such as secondary excavation of the backfill body,frequent handling of rock drilling equipment and slag extraction equipment,hidden safety hazards in the production of backfill retaining walls,and long production continuation time between chambers.This paper expounds the process of replacing the filling body with airbags.The process is mainly to adjust the position of the filling retaining wall outwards,place an inflatable bag in the filling retaining wall,place a water filter pipe around the airbag,and use the airbag to occupy a certain volume.Therefore,it is not necessary to excavate the filling body twice when the adjacent chambers are mined.This process eliminates the need for secondary excavation of the filling body before the mining of adjacent chambers in the panel,shortens the mining connection time between mine houses by about 15 days;solves the problem that the filling body needs to be raised to the surface separately;improves the production efficiency,which provides experience for similar mines using filling method mining.
